Golden Faith Group Holdings Limited operates as an investment holding enterprise with a primary focus on furnishing electrical and mechanical (E&M) engineering services throughout Hong Kong. The company's expertise covers a wide array of engineering solutions, including the implementation of electrical and extra-low voltage (ELV) systems, alongside ventilation and air-conditioning installations. Furthermore, it offers integrated services for the management, installation, supervision, and testing of these electrical and ELV systems. Beyond its core engineering operations, Golden Faith is also engaged in property investment. It serves both public and private sector clients, undertaking projects for diverse building types such as residential and commercial complexes, institutional buildings, government facilities, hotels, and hospitals. Founded in 1987, its corporate headquarters are located in Causeway Bay, Hong Kong.

How to read a P/E ratio?

The Price/Earnings ratio measures the relationship between a company's stock price and its earnings per share.
A low but positive P/E ratio stands for a company that is generating high earnings compared to its current valuation and might be undervalued. A company with a high negative (near 0) P/E ratio stands for a company that is generating heavy losses compared to its current valuation.

Companies with a P/E ratio over 30 or a negative one are generaly seen as "growth stocks" meaning that investors typically expect the company to grow or to become profitable in the future.

Companies with a positive P/E ratio bellow 10 are generally seen as "value stocks" meaning that the company is already very profitable and unlikely to strong growth in the future.
